All Categories
Featured
Table of Contents
These concerns are after that shared with your future recruiters so you don't get asked the same questions twice. Each recruiter will evaluate you on the four main attributes Google looks for when working with: Depending upon the specific job you're looking for these attributes may be damaged down even more. For example, "Role-related understanding and experience" can be broken down into "Safety architecture" or "Event feedback" for a website integrity engineer duty.
In this center section, Google's job interviewers typically repeat the questions they asked you, document your solutions carefully, and offer you a rating for each attribute (e.g. "Poor", "Mixed", "Good", "Excellent"). Recruiters will certainly create a summary of your efficiency and offer an overall recommendation on whether they think Google needs to be employing you or not (e.g.
At this stage, the employing committee will certainly make a recommendation on whether Google ought to hire you or not. If the employing board suggests that you get hired you'll typically begin your team matching process. To put it simply, you'll talk with employing managers and one or several of them will certainly require to be happy to take you in their team in order for you to obtain an offer from the business.
Yes, Google software engineer interviews are very difficult. The interview procedure is made to extensively examine a candidate's technological abilities and general suitability for the duty. It normally covers coding meetings where you'll need to use information frameworks or algorithms to resolve issues, you can also expect behavioral "inform me regarding a time." concerns.
Google software designers resolve some of one of the most difficult issues the business faces with code. It's consequently crucial that they have strong problem-solving skills. This is the part of the meeting where you desire to reveal that you believe in an organized means and compose code that's accurate, bug-free, and quickly.
Please keep in mind the list below omits system style and behavioral questions, which we'll cover later in this short article. Graphs/ Trees (39% of questions, a lot of frequent) Ranges/ Strings (26%) Dynamic programming (12%) Recursion (12%) Geometry/ Maths (11% of inquiries, the very least frequent) Below, we've noted common examples utilized at Google for each of these various concern types.
"Given a binary tree, find the maximum path amount. "We can revolve digits by 180 degrees to form new figures.
When 2, 3, 4, 5, and 7 are turned 180 degrees, they come to be void. A confusing number is a number that when rotated 180 degrees ends up being a different number with each digit legitimate.(Note that the turned number can be above the initial number.) Provided a positive integer N, return the variety of complex numbers in between 1 and N comprehensive." (Solution) "Offered 2 words (beginWord and endWord), and a dictionary's word listing, find the size of quickest improvement sequence from beginWord to endWord, such that: 1) Just one letter can be transformed at once and, 2) Each transformed word needs to exist in words list." (Solution) "Offered a matrix of N rows and M columns.
When it tries to move into a blocked cell, its bumper sensor identifies the obstacle and it remains on the current cell. Carry out a SnapshotArray that sustains pre-defined interfaces (note: see web link for more details).
(A domino is a ceramic tile with two numbers from 1 to 6 - one on each half of the ceramic tile.) We might turn the i-th domino, to make sure that A [i] and B [i] swap values. Return the minimal variety of rotations so that all the values in A coincide, or all the worths in B are the same.
Often, when inputting a personality c, the key might get long pressed, and the character will certainly be typed 1 or more times. You check out the typed characters of the key-board. Return True if it is feasible that it was your buddies name, with some characters (possibly none) being long pushed." (Option) "Given a string S and a string T, find the minimum home window in S which will consist of all the personalities in T in complexity O(n)." (Service) "Offered a listing of question words, return the number of words that are elastic." Note: see web link for more information.
"A strobogrammatic number is a number that looks the very same when rotated 180 degrees (looked at upside down). "Provided a binary tree, discover the size of the longest path where each node in the path has the same worth.
Table of Contents
Latest Posts
How To Explain Machine Learning Algorithms In Interviews
How To Succeed In Data Engineering Interviews – A Comprehensive Guide
The Best Strategies For Answering Faang Behavioral Interview Questions
More
Latest Posts
How To Explain Machine Learning Algorithms In Interviews
How To Succeed In Data Engineering Interviews – A Comprehensive Guide
The Best Strategies For Answering Faang Behavioral Interview Questions